Subject: Re: [docbook-apps] Re: DocBook XSL 1.67.0 released
Norman Walsh wrote: > That is the question. I don't know what the right answer is, but here's > my current thinking: > > 1. Define a parameter that contains default content for a style element > in the head. > 2. Define a parameter that contains user-specified content for a style > element in the head, initially empty. > 3. If the user specifies an external CSS stylesheet or user-specified > content for the style element, use that. Otherwise use the default > content. Sounds reasonable. We also could parametrize whether default style goes into head or into external CSS stylesheets. Having it in head is good for non-chunked output because output is not depending on any other file. But when doing chunking user must already cope with set of files so generating external CSS has sense IMHO.
